Index of /bucket/59/a8/1b/


../
bucket-59a81b0781c40f2f31c53847eb3083e7ba36dc67..> 22-Feb-2026 03:01             4434980
bucket-59a81b939628da560f23ec1676c744ddd5e7a0d5..> 04-Jan-2022 15:09              604724